The Opera House was built in four stages: stage I (1957–1959) was planning out the building; stage II (1959–1963) consisted of building the upper podium; stage III (1963–1967) the construction of the outer shells, based upon the image of whales breaching the water; stage IV (1967–1973) interior design and construction.

With the election of the Askin government in 1965, Hughes became Minister for Public Works, [3] with responsibility for, among other things, the completion of the Sydney Opera House. Hughes refused to accept Jørn Utzon 's approach to managing the Opera House project and, specifically, the construction of plywood prototypes for its interiors.
